Nurses Begin Seven-Day Warning Strike

Nurses across Nigeria under the aegis of the National Association of Nigeria Nurses and Midwives (NANNM) have commenced a seven-day warning strike to protest poor welfare and deplorable working conditions in the country’s healthcare sector.

According to the nurses, the industrial action became necessary after repeated appeals to the Federal Government for better remuneration, improved workplace safety, and a halt to what they describe as “massive brain drain” fell on deaf ears.

NANNM President, Michael Nnachi, in a statement, urged the government to meet their demands within the seven-day window or risk an indefinite nationwide shutdown of nursing services.
